KYC Center Volunteers support and engage with our participants during Center programming. Volunteers must be 23 years of age or older and must complete an interview, training session, and background check before joining us. Center volunteers generally commit to one 2 or 4-hour volunteer shift per week, support programming, and keep our Center a positive, safe, and empowering space. The Volunteer Orientation training is offered on an on-going basis and provides important information and skills specifically related to working with LGBTQ young people.

Mission Statement
Kaleidoscope Youth Center works in partnership with young people in Central Ohio to create safe and empowering environments for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ender, Queer, Questioning (LGBTQ), and Ally youth through advocacy, education, support, and community engagement.
Description
Kaleidoscope Youth Center is the only organization in Ohio solely dedicated to the success of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ender, Questioning (LGBTQ) and Ally youth.
Kaleidoscope serves youth ages 12-20 through a community youth center, Genders and Sexualities Alliances (GSA) clubs, and a Youth Leadership Council. Kaleidoscope also serves youth by training, educating, and equipping adults to create supportive, safe spaces for Queer youth.
